Sunshine Coast Inspired Minds Lunch

An opportunity for women, and the people who support them, to discuss a range of building and construction industry business topics.

Turning your obstacles into your biggest motivators

Ladies luncheon with panel discussion on career pathways, industry success, and obstacles along the way.


Join us on Thursday, 6 June as we host the 2024 Sunshine Coast Inspired Minds luncheon at the beautiful Lakehouse. We are bringing together three inspiring women from different backgrounds and sectors of the workforce to share how they entered the industry and turned obstacles into their greatest motivators.

In a panel discussion moderated by our very-own Deputy CEO, Sue-Ann Fresneda, our all-female panel will take you through how they deviated from their already successful careers in real estate, nursing and HR and created their own pathway in the building and construction industry.

This is a great opportunity to get your team together and hear from our panel of trailblazers on how you too can turn negatives into motivation, and pave your own way to success.

OUR SPEAKERS

REBECCA CLATWORTHY

Director | One Life Property Group

After a decade-long career in Real Estate, and completing a bachelor’s degree in construction management, Rebecca took on a role as estimator and contract administrator with both a project home builder and large-scale renovation builder.

Using her life and professional experience, Rebecca and her business partner Chris, took a leap of faith and launched OneLife Property Group, both working in their existing roles for other companies for a full year whilst the business got off the ground.

OneLife has gone on to win awards two years in a row at the Master Builders Sunshine Coast and Queensland Housing & Construction Awards, and taking home a National award last year.

STEPHANIE NUDD

Sales & Administration | Buildmast

Having worked as a nurse and midwife for fifteen years, Stephanie took the leap a few years ago to support her partner Jeremy in taking Buildmast to the next level. Stephanie wears many hats within Buildmast including HR, payroll, accounts, WHS, styling for photoshoots, website & social media and more, all while focusing on her passion as a mid-wife.

MEGAN NASTROM

Co-founder | Ultra Living Homes

With a degree in accounting, Megan’s initial role was predominantly in running the accounts department and HR. Megan is ow the leading force behind all of Ultra’s display homes, from initial conception of plan design brief, colour selections, on site progress, marketing, and display home staging.

Last year, Ultra Living Homes was awarded the Master Builders Sunshine Coast and Wide Bay Burnett Display Home Award in the $450k to $550k category, also winning in the same category at the Master Builders Queensland Awards.

Queensland Garden Expo

In 2024 the Queensland Garden Expo will celebrate their 40th Anniversary over four special days. Held at Nambour on the beautiful Sunshine Coast, it is ideally situated to showcase all the best of subtropical gardening. An extensive Lecture and Demonstration Program, Landscape Display Gardens, over 360 exhibits including 55 nurseries, a Giant Kitchen Garden Feature and a cooking stage are just a few of the things visitors can enjoy at the Expo. Great food, entertainment and a range of free children's activities all combine to make Queensland Garden Expo a great day out for all the family.
